Gander International Airport (YQX) is a vital transportation hub serving both tourists and residents of the Gander region. While not a large international airport, it plays a significant role in connecting Newfoundland and Labrador to other parts of Canada. The airport is known for its historical significance, particularly its role in accommodating transatlantic flights before modern long-range aircraft became common.
Gander International Airport (YQX) is located at 1000 James Boulevard, Gander, Newfoundland and Labrador, Canada. It's situated a short drive from the town center of Gander, making it easily accessible for travelers.
